Egypt’s Prime Minister Mostafa Madbouly on Sunday held a crucial meeting to accelerate the preparation of state-owned companies for public offerings and devise strategies to invigorate the Egyptian Exchange (EGX). The government views the EGX as a key platform for attracting private sector investment into its privatisation programme. The meeting, held at the Cabinet headquarters, […]
